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al Cost in Freetown, MA

The cost of hydrostatic pressure water removal in Freetown, MA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ices are competitive and based on the specific needs of your property. We’ll work with you to develop a customized plan and provide a detailed estimate of the costs involved. Our goal is to ensure your property is restored to its pre-damage state, while also being mindful of your budget.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and drying $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ions
Cleaning and disinfecting $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, type of surfaces
Dehumidification and air movement $100 – $500 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Structural drying and repair $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, type of materials
Contents cleaning and drying $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of contents
Final inspection and certification $100 – $500 Size of affected area, type of services needed

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ment and a detailed evaluation of your property’s specific needs. We offer free estimates and will work with you to develop a customized plan and budget. Q: What are the health risks associated with hydrostatic pressure water damage?

A: Hydrostatic pressure water damage can pose serious health risks, including the growth of mold and mildew, which can exacerbate respiratory issues such as asthma. Also, standing water can harbor bacteria and other microorganisms that can cause illness.
